About the Company

Founded in 1984, Nationwide Guard Services, Inc. prioritizes client protection through superior mentorship and training for its officers.

Expert Review

Nationwide Guard Services for its commitment to training and ethical service. With roles offering $17 - $19 per hour, it provides a competitive entry-level wage. The benefits package includes medical, dental, and vision insurance, which is commendable for part-time roles.

The company's strict dress code, particularly the no-visible-tattoo policy, may limit some applicants. For those who prioritize professionalism and are open to a controlled appearance, this could be a non-issue. It's also important to note that while the company promotes a supportive environment, advancement opportunities may vary based on location.

If you're looking to enter the security field, Nationwide Guard Services offers a well-rounded experience. The focus on mentorship and officer well-being is a significant plus, but be prepared for the company's standards regarding appearance.
